1.A.130.1.1 Nortia (Nta), the Ca2+ channel protein of 895 aas and ~ 10 TMSs in a 1 + 1 + 2 + 6 [2 + 2 + 2) TMS arrangement (O22752); Feronia (Fer) a receptor-like kinase and constituent of a transmembrane calmodulin-gated calcium (Ca2+) channel protein complexof 542 aas, an MLO-like protein, and Lorleei (Lre, glycosyl PI anchor protein of 165 aas with 2 TMSs, one N-terminal and one C-terminal (B3GS44) (Gao et al. 2022). The channel protein (Nortia) functions in conjunction with these two other proteins, Feronia (Fer), a receptor-like protein kinase, and Lorelei (Lre), a GPI-anchored protein. See the family description, paragraph 1 and Gao et al. 2022 for more details. Two pollen-tube-derived small peptides that belong to the rapid alkalinzation factor (RALF) family seem to be ligands for the FER-LRE co-receptor, which in turn recruits NTA to the plasm membrane. NTA initiates Ca2+ spiking in the synergid cells, for pollen tube reception. Thus, the FER-LRE-NTA complex forms a receptor-channel complex in the female cell to recognize male signals and trigger tertilization.
